55 DIGEST OF INTRODUCED BILL
66 Citations Affected: IC 35-31.5-2; IC 35-43-2.5.
77 Synopsis: Use of public restrooms. Makes it a Class B misdemeanor
88 if: (1) a male knowingly or intentionally enters a restroom that is
99 designated to be used only by females; or (2) a female knowingly or
1010 intentionally enters a restroom that is designated to be used only by
1111 males. Provides certain defenses.
1212 Effective: July 1, 2025.

2626 HOUSE BILL No. 1342
2727 A BILL FOR AN ACT to amend the Indiana Code concerning
2828 criminal law and procedure.
2929 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the State of Indiana:
3030 1 SECTION 1. IC 35-31.5-2-130.3 IS ADDED TO THE INDIANA
3131 2 CODE AS A NEW SECTION TO READ AS FOLLOWS
3232 3 [EFFECTIVE JULY 1, 2025]: Sec. 130.3. "Female", for purposes of
3333 4 IC 35-43-2.5, has the meaning set forth in IC 35-43-2.5-1.
3434 5 SECTION 2. IC 35-31.5-2-191.5 IS ADDED TO THE INDIANA
3535 6 CODE AS A NEW SECTION TO READ AS FOLLOWS
3636 7 [EFFECTIVE JULY 1, 2025]: Sec. 191.5. "Male", for purposes of
3737 8 IC 35-43-2.5, has the meaning set forth in IC 35-43-2.5-2.
3838 9 SECTION 3. IC 35-43-2.5 IS ADDED TO THE INDIANA CODE
3939 10 AS A NEW CHAPTER TO READ AS FOLLOWS [EFFECTIVE
4040 11 JULY 1, 2025]:
4141 12 Chapter 2.5. Single Sex Public Restroom Trespass
4242 13 Sec. 1. As used in this chapter, "female" means an individual
4343 14 who:
4444 15 (1) was born female at birth; or
4545 16 (2) has at least one (1) X chromosome and no Y chromosome.
4646 17 Sec. 2. As used in this chapter, "male" means an individual who:

4848 1 (1) was born male at birth; or
4949 2 (2) has at least one (1) X chromosome and at least one (1) Y
5050 3 chromosome.
5151 4 Sec. 3. A:
5252 5 (1) male who knowingly or intentionally enters a restroom
5353 6 that is designated to be used only by females; or
5454 7 (2) female who knowingly or intentionally enters a restroom
5555 8 that is designated to be used only by males;
5656 9 commits restroom trespass, a Class B misdemeanor.
5757 10 Sec. 4. (a) It is a defense to a prosecution under this chapter if
5858 11 a person enters a restroom designated only for the opposite gender:
5959 12 (1) for custodial purposes; or
6060 13 (2) to render assistance.
6161 14 (b) It is a defense to a prosecution under this chapter if a person
6262 15 who is less than twelve (12) years of age accompanies the person's:
6363 16 (1) parent;
6464 17 (2) guardian;
6565 18 (3) custodian;
6666 19 (4) teacher; or
6767 20 (5) babysitter;
6868 21 into a restroom designated for the gender of the person listed in
6969 22 subdivisions (1) through (5).
